Rigorous Physical and Academic Standards
Admission to the academy is competitive and begins with meeting stringent prerequisites. Candidates must pass a thorough background investigation, a medical examination, and a psychological evaluation. The physical fitness test is a significant hurdle, requiring exceptional endurance, strength, and agility. Academically, recruits are expected to master complex topics ranging from criminal law and constitutional rights to report writing and firearms safety. The intellectual demands are as challenging as the physical ones, ensuring only the most qualified individuals advance.

Comprehensive Training Modules
The curriculum is divided into several critical modules that prepare recruits for the realities of the job. Firearms training emphasizes safety, accuracy, and decision-making in high-stress situations. Defensive tactics instruction teaches officers how to control suspects without resorting to unnecessary force. Criminal investigation, patrol procedures, and traffic enforcement are also core components. Each module is taught by experienced instructors who bring real-world experience into the classroom, bridging the gap between theory and practice.
